  3. COOPER, ROY DALE (1955– ). Born on November 13, 1955, in Hobbs, New Mexico, rodeo champion Roy Dale Cooper was the son of rancher and champion roper Dale "Tuffy" Cooper and Betty Rose Hadley Cooper, who had been raised on a ranch near Indiahoma, Oklahoma. Roy Cooper was raised on the Coopers' family ranch near Monument, New Mexico.

  6. Born: November 13, 1955, in Hobbs, NM. High School: Hobbs High School College: Cisco Junior College Southeastern Oklahoma State University – degree in journalism. Roy is the son of Dale “Tuffy” and Betty Cooper. His parents named him after Roy Lewis, a famous roper in the 1930’s and 1940’s. His parents met at the Cameron College rodeo.
